This statement makes
it
possible to use the color
plotter
-printer
as
a display unit.
Thus,
the
MZ-700 can be used
without
an external display screen.
This statement is effective only when
the
color plotter-printer
is
installed and the
MODE TN statement has been previously executed.
PLOT ON
A period " . " is printed to represent any characters which are
not
stored in the
color plotter-printer's character generator (see page 156). The
I INST I , I DEL l·and
"
El
" keys are disabled
by
executing this statement. I CTRL I+
IQ]
can be used
to
change
the
pen.

This statement specifies
the
size
of
the scroll area;
i.
e., the area which
is
cleared by
PRINT
11
[!]
11
•
The first example specifies
the
entire screen as the scroll area. The second specifies
the
area between lines 5 and
15
as the scroll area. The third specifies the area bet-
ween columns 5
and
30 as the scroll area. The fourth specifies
the
10 x 10 positions
at
the
upper
left
corner
of
the screen
as
the scroll area.
This
statement
is
useful for excluding the left
and/or
right edges
of
the image from
the
display area. When
they
are hidden beh.ind
the
edges
of
the screen.
The last example does
not
specify the scroll area. When
the
scroll area
is
not
speci-
fied,
it
is possible
to
scroll the screen
up
or
down.
However, this makes it harder to perform screen editing because the values
of
Cn
and In become smaller.
